High needs is a state count, not a score. It includes every student who is from a low income household, learning English, or receiving special education services, and counts each one only once. The median across all 396 Massachusetts districts is 46.7 percent.

Academic Performance & Context
Warwick Community School is a small elementary district serving the town’s youngest grades, so it has no graduation rate of its own, and students continue their schooling outside Warwick once they finish here. MCAS results and accountability data are published and updated each year by DESE, so this guide links to the live state profile rather than reprinting numbers that quickly go stale. With about 47 students, a single class can move any percentage sharply from one year to the next, which is worth remembering when you read a small district’s scores.
